ATLANTA-- Georgia State women's track and field team impressed this weekend with nine top five finishes, and a win from
Marissa Palmer at the Don McGarey Invitational in Kennesaw on Saturday afternoon.

Marissa Palmer claimed the top spot at the podium in the 100-meter with a time of 11.59. She also participated on the 4x100 relay team that finished second with a 45.30 time;Â
Justein Whyte,
Laila Eiland and
Lailah Palmer were also on the relay team that claimed the second place finish.Â
Jessica James jumped her way to a second-place finish in the triple jump with a distance of 12.10 meters.
Lailah Palmer also boasted an impressive time of 12.00 earning herself fourth place in the event.Â

Junior
Shadae Worrell accounted for another top five finish for the Panthers, coming in fifth in the 400-meter final with a time of 57.40.Â
Â
Â
The Panthers received three top six finishes in the 800-meter, with
Kennedy Morris leading the way in fourth place (2:15.78). Right behind her was
Laure Kidukula in fifth (2:16.08), followed by Mencia Maruri who placed sixth (2:22.20).Â
Â
Â
Freshman Yolanda Brooks came away with a fifth-place finish in the 1500-meter running it in 4:55.99.
Â
Â
Zyra Shivers also earned herself a fifth-place finish by running the 100 hurdles in a time of 14.05.
Â
Â
Kennedy Morris,
Janiyah Alibey,
Justein Whyte, and
Laure Kidukula also earned second place in the 4 x 400 relay.
